Output 14d40d187cb8d765b0c4a8bf664bc625261cfff746b0bcb57f150f707eae69b9:0

value
23561
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ebc5f4eeb43713da4b95e1dead9f365319dbd39b OP_EQUAL
address
3PBfruDyZ5mdctHZgEMPPVBRgiUVK1DSqL
transaction
14d40d187cb8d765b0c4a8bf664bc625261cfff746b0bcb57f150f707eae69b9
spent
true